Struct NegativeCache 

Source
pub struct NegativeCache {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

A TTL-keyed negative result cache.

Implementations§

Source§

impl NegativeCache

Source

pub fn new(ttl_ms: u64) -> Self

Create a new NegativeCache with the given TTL in milliseconds.

Source

pub fn insert_miss(&mut self, key: &str, now_ms: u64)

Record key as a known miss at timestamp now_ms.

If an entry for key already exists it is overwritten with the new timestamp (refreshing the TTL).

Source

pub fn is_known_miss(&self, key: &str, now_ms: u64) -> bool

Returns true when key is a known miss that has not yet expired.

A miss entry at recorded_ms expires when now_ms >= recorded_ms + ttl_ms.

Source

pub fn remove(&mut self, key: &str)

Remove the entry for key (e.g. after it has been successfully populated in the origin cache).

Source

pub fn evict_expired(&mut self, now_ms: u64)

Prune all entries that have expired by now_ms.

Source

pub fn len(&self) -> usize

Number of currently tracked negative entries (including expired ones that have not been pruned yet).

Source

pub fn is_empty(&self) -> bool

Returns true when no entries are tracked.

Source

pub fn ttl_ms(&self) -> u64

The configured TTL in milliseconds.

Source

pub fn clear(&mut self)

Clear all entries.
